5 Supplements Every Aging Pet Should Consider

The Pet ExpertThe Pet Expert—January 5, 20240

If you’ve got an aging fur baby, you know they might not be as quick to leap up for a spontaneous game of fetch or a laser pointer chase. But don’t fret, my pet-loving pals. Aging is just a new chapter, and with the right supplements, you can help your pet flip those pages with vigor. Here’s the scoop on five supplement superheroes that deserve a spot in your senior pet’s daily routine.

The Joint Guardian: Glucosamine

Let’s kick things off with glucosamine. This supplement is like the WD-40 for creaky pet joints. It helps keep those knees cushiony and movements smooth. Think of it as helping your pet channel their inner yoga instructor – more “upward-facing dog” and less “stiff as a board”.

The Memory Maestro: Omega-3 Fatty Acids

Omega-3s aren’t just fancy fish oil; they’re brain food. They keep your pet’s mind as sharp as a tack – because remembering where that bone is buried is crucial. Plus, they give a glossy sheen to their coat, turning heads at the dog park or making other cats utterly jealous.

The Digestive Dancer: Probiotics

A pet’s gut should do more than just process yesterday’s kibble. Probiotics are the backup dancers for your pet’s digestive system, helping to keep everything in rhythm. A happy gut means less gas that silently clears a room and more healthy bathroom breaks.

The Energy Engineer: Antioxidants

Antioxidants are like internal mechanics, keeping your pet’s cells running smoothly and helping to reduce the rust of aging. They’re the unsung heroes fighting the good fight against wear and tear, ensuring your pet stays lively and ready for action.

The Sunshine Sidekick: Vitamin D

While our pets can’t exactly soak up Vitamin D from sunbathing like we do (fur problems), a little supplement boost can work wonders. It keeps bones strong and supports the overall well-being of your graying companion. After all, we want them trotting alongside us for as long as possible.

Supplementing the Love Now, before you start a supplement shopping spree, remember – chat with your vet. Your pet’s as individual as a snowflake, and their needs are too. The right dose and the right product matter.

And one more thing – supplements are great, but they’re just part of the senior pet care package. Love, attention, and belly rubs are just as important. Combine all that, and you’re set to give your pet the best twilight years they could ask for.
